Basketball
St. Rose participates in the North Bay Catholic Schools League. We have our own boys’ and girls’ basketball teams. All students may play on these teams without need for tryout. These teams are coordinated by our Athletic Director and coached by parent volunteers. Signups go home via the Wednesday Envelope in August. Link to PDF of Documents
- Boys Junior Varsity – 5th and 6th Grade Teams
- Girls Junior Varsity – 5th and 6th Grade Teams
- Boys Varsity – 7th and 8th Grade Teams
- Girls Varsity – 7th and 8th Grade Teams
Volleyball
St. Rose also offers Volleyball for grades five through eight (girls teams every year, boys based on available players). The volleyball teams are part of the North Bay Catholic Schools League. These teams are coordinated by our Athletic Director and coached by parent volunteers. Signups go home via the Wednesday Envelope in May. Link to PDF of Documents.
- Boys – One Team – 5th through 8th Grade
- Girls Junior Varsity – 5th and 6th Grade Teams
- Girls Varsity – 7th and 8th Grade Teams
